The Legal 500 Recognizes Finnegan as a Tier One IP Law Firm

June 4, 2015

The Legal 500

F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E
June 4, 2015

WASHINGTON, DC—For the seventh consecutive year, The Legal 500 U.S. has ranked Finnegan, Henderson, Farabow, Garrett & Dunner, LLP, as a Tier 1 firm in the intellectual property categories of Patent Litigation: Full Coverage; Patent Litigation: International Trade Commission; Patent Licensing and Transactional; Patent Prosecution: Utility and Design Patents; and Trademarks: Non-contentious. The 2015 rankings identify Finnegan as an “IP powerhouse” that is “dependable and highly competent.” The directory specifically notes Finnegan’s work in the technology sector across all categories.

In addition to receiving high overall firm practice rankings, the following Finnegan attorneys were singled out as “Leading Lawyers” for their experience and accomplishments in the practice of intellectual property law:

Patent litigation: Full Coverage

Donald R. Dunner
Charles E. Lipsey

Patent prosecution: Utility and Design Patents

Mark D. Sweet

About Finnegan

Finnegan is one of the largest IP law firms in the world. From offices in Atlanta, Boston, London, Palo Alto, Reston, Shanghai, Taipei, Tokyo, and Washington, DC, the firm practices all aspects of patent, trademark, copyright, and trade secret law, including counseling, prosecution, licensing, and litigation. Finnegan also represents clients on IP issues related to international trade, portfolio management, the Internet, e-commerce, government contracts, antitrust, and unfair competition.
